Vocabulary

Use of 'dismiss' and 'end' with school

Hi

Could you please tell me how you find the use of 'end' and 'dismiss' with school?

  1. We often went to the old shop after school was dismissed.
  2. We often went to the old shop after school ended.
  3. What time is your school dismissed on Fridays?
  4. What time does your school end on Fridays?
  5. School ended early because of the harsh weather.
  6. School was dismissed early because of the harsh weather.

Mr. TomWe often went to the old shop after school was dismissed.

No. Nobody would say anything but "We often went to the old shop after school."

Mr. TomWe often went to the old shop after school ended.

No. "Ended" does not work in this context.
